Anti-PSD93 antibodies enable researchers to detect and measure the PSD93 antigen in biological samples. This target is a reported synonym of the DLG2 gene, which encodes discs large MAGUK scaffold protein 2. This protein is known to function in chemical synaptic transmission, among other biological roles. The human version of PSD93 has a canonical amino acid length of 870 residues and a protein mass of 97.6 kilodaltons, although 5 isoforms have been identified. It is reported to be localized in the cell membrane of cells and notably expressed in the rectum, hippocampus, cerebral cortex, and cerebellum. Other names for this target antigen include PPP1R58 and PSD-93. Indicated applications for PSD93 antibodies listed below include ELISA, Western Blot, Immunoprecipitation, and Immunohistochemistry.
